The 4 most common types of movers when moving from Henderson to Spring Valley are full-service movers, labor-only movers, moving containers, and rental trucks.

  • Full-service movers handle everything from packing in Henderson to driving and unloading in Spring Valley, but cost the most
  • Labor-only services work well if you only want a crew for the heavy lifting
  • Moving containers balance price and effort, but you handle loading or hire labor separately
  • Rental trucks are the cheapest if you're comfortable driving 19 miles and require your full effort or hiring labor

How much does it cost to move from Henderson to Spring Valley?

It costs between $38 to $3,876 to move from Henderson to Spring Valley. The prices below break down your 19-mile move costs by type of moving service and home size.

  • Full service movers: $485 - $3,876
  • Moving containers: $121 - $1,612
  • Rental trucks: $38 - $157
Home size Full-service mover Moving container Rental truck
Studio / 1 bedroom $485 - $1,390 $121 - $789 $38 - $100
2 - 3 bedrooms $851 - $2,759 $368 - $1,132 $51 - $114
4+ bedrooms $1,263 - $3,876 $792 - $1,612 $65 - $157

Extra costs to budget for

Most quotes won't include these line items by default — confirm each one with your mover or rental company before booking.

Extra cost Typical range Applies to
Packing service $333 - $2,775+ Full-service movers
Loading labor $90/hr per mover Moving containers, rental trucks
Storage About $80/month Moving containers
Shuttle fee $222 - $888 Full-service movers
Equipment rental $56 - $222 Rental trucks
Added protection 1% - 2% of declared value All move types

How far in advance should I book Henderson-to-Spring Valley movers?

To make your move from Henderson to Spring Valley as stress-free as possible, lock in your movers at least two months before your big day. If you’re planning a summer move, aim for three months ahead, because spots fill up fast! Booking early not only boosts your chances of getting the date you want, but you might also score a better deal since many companies offer early-bird discounts for customers who plan ahead.

What time of year is the cheapest to move to Spring Valley?

The cheapest time of year to move to Spring Valley is between early October and late April. This period is outside of the moving industry’s peak season (May–September), which means demand — and therefore pricing — will typically be lower. A majority of U.S. moves happen between May and August, so staying outside the busy summer months will help you save money.
